Culinary Stage @ 2011 Taste of Buffalo

Feed Your Soul is proud to present a variety of culinary competitions and expositions at the Taste of Buffalo presented by TOPS. Taste of Buffalo is the second largest food festival int he United States. Come down and visit us and you may be selected to participate as a judge!

Meet some of Buffalo’s best chefs, witness exciting competitions and learn how to prepare some delicious dishes! It’s like watching Food Network live!

Saturday, July 9th 2011

Noon-1pm  Sous Chef Battle
Featuring James Gehrke of Sample versus Ryan McNeela of Creekview

Chef James Gehrke of Sample (Buffalo) and Chef Ryan McNeela of Creekview (Williamsville), will compete to complete the best dishes in 45 minutes. Each dish must feature a secret ingredient! This should be a fierce competition, as a restaurant’s second in command is rarely given the opportunity to show their culinary ability in a public forum. Judges for this event include: Chef Mike Andrzejewski of the critically-acclaimed Sea Bar, Alan Bedenko, food critic for Buffalo Spree magazine, Kevin Telaak, vice president of Artisan Kitchens & Baths, and one lucky audience member.

2pm-3pm  Nickel City Chef Presents Battle: Taco
Featuring Krista Van Wagner of Curly’s versus JJ Richert of Torches

There are a thousand ways to make a taco, but which one is best? Nickel City Chef Krista Van Wagner of Curly’s (Lackawanna) will compete against Nickel City Chef JJ Richert of Torches (Kenmore) to win the hearts of our panel of judges with their best interpretation of the humble taco. Judges for this event include: Musician and foodie Nelson Starr, chef and cookbook author (Mexican Flavors, 2010) Laura Anhalt, food blogger Don Burtless of BuffaloEats.org, and one lucky audience member.

Sunday, July 10th 2011

11am-11:30am  Flapjack Fun
Featuring Marco Sciortino of Marco’s versus Tucker Curtin of Lake Effect Diner

A panel of kid judges pick the perfect pancake. Marco Sciortino of Marco’s and Tucker Curtin of Lake Effect Diner flip their favorite flapjacks in hopes of being crowned the Prince of Pancakes.

º

Noon-1pm  All Prepped Out!
sponsored by CUTCO
Featuring Brett Brennan of Sea Bar, Ken Foland of Merge, and  Hanna Youngling of Toro!

Chef Brett Brennan of Sea Bar (Buffalo), Ken Foland of Merge (Buffalo), and Chef Hanna Youngling of Toro (Buffalo) are vying for a trophy and bragging rights with this exciting competition. Speed, dexterity, and skill are required as these chefs race through a series of timed heats based on basic kitchen skills (i.e. chopping onions, separating eggs, julienning carrots, breaking down chickens). In this competition, precision and technique are as important as finishing first. Judges for this event include: Chef Mark Mistriner and Chef John Matwijkow of Niagara Culinary Institute, and Chef John Santora of Alfred State College.

2pm-3pm  Nickel City Chef Presents: Battle: Street Food
Featuring Adam Goetz of Sample versus Mary Ann Giordano of Creekview

Street food is all the rage, and in this exposition, Nickel City Chef Adam Goetz of Sample (Buffalo) will compete against Nickel City Challenger Mary Ann Giordano of Creekview Restaurant (Williamsville) to win the hearts of our panel of judges with their best savory street food item. Judges include: Pete Cimino and Chef Chris Dorsaneo, founders of Buffalo’s first food truck, Lloyd, well-respected local chef, James Roberts of Park Country Club, and one lucky audience member.
